Post by Ben-Ohki on Apr 12, 2007 15:09:09 GMT -5
Under $40, I'd go with either of the 8th MS Team Gundams (Ez-8 or RX-79(G) kits). I've built both of these and they come with a crazy number of weapons that can all be stored in the "backpack" - great for doing dioramas or something.
The GP-03S was also cool with its optional Core-Fighter (but not optional as in, you can only build with or without! I mean optional as in you get enough parts to actually build separate and transformable Core Fighter that will fit IN the Gundam itself!).
